Flexible Couplings - With rubber spacer with high damping capacity, XGT2-C/XGL2-C/XGS2-C series.
NBK
High damping capacity rubber-type standard coupling.
[Features]
· High-damping flexible coupling surpassing XGT, XGL and XGS.
· Aluminum hubs on both ends are molded with vibration-proof rubber in a completely integrated structure.
· Optimum design of damping and rigidity achieves higher servo motor gain, shortening settling time.
· Effective in suppressing speed irregularities during stepping motor drive.
· Suppresses residual vibration upon positioning and contributes to improved productivity and quality.
· Superior heat resistance, oil resistance and chemical resistance.
[Applications]
· Semiconductor manufacturing machinery, mounting machinery, machine tools, packaging machinery, etc.
